Test results for on-campus students (n=6273)

Teststotal Testspositive(% of Teststotal) Ntested Npositive(% of Ntested)
Online instruction (Aug 19 to Sept 20) 12 040 349 (2·9%) 6254 326 (5·2%)
Pre-arrival and arrival testing (Sept 1–20)* 11 028 190 (1·7%) 5963 179 (3·0%)
Voluntary testing post arrival (Sept 12–20) 605 19 (3·1%) 574 19 (3·3%)
In-person instruction (Sept 21 to Nov 25) 33 510 1277 (3·8%) 5870 1234 (21·0%)
Surveillance testing 29 658 788 (2·7%) 5552 770 (13·9%)
Voluntary testing 3852 489 (12·7%) 2554 480 (18·8%)
SBIT (Sept 23 to Oct 5) 6353 664 (10·5%) 4741 645 (13·6%)
Surveillance testing 5379 387 (7·2%) 4296 379 (8·8%)
Random testing 3420 179 (5·2%) 2911 176 (6·0%)
Targeted testing 1959 208 (10·6%) 1872 203 (10·8%)
Voluntary testing 974 277 (28·4%) 867 273 (31·5%)
Weekly testing (Oct 6 to Nov 22) 25 937 567 (2·2%) 5183 551 (10·6%)
Surveillance testing 24 278 401 (1·7%) 4958 391 (7·9%)
Voluntary testing 1659 166 (10·0%) 1094 165 (15·1%)

Data are n or n (%), and all dates are for 2020. We define Teststotal as the number of COVID-19 tests and Testspositive as the number of COVID-19 positive tests. NTested is the number of unique individuals tested for COVID-19 and NPositive is the number of unique individuals with a positive test result. Because of the potential of multiple testing categories per student, the total number of students tested and those testing positive will not necessarily add up to the N within each period. SBIT=surveillance-based informative testing.

*

Test completed within 10 days before arrival or within 2 days after arrival.

Voluntary tests are defined as tests not mandated by the university surveillance strategy and include testing of symptomatic students, students directed to testing by contact tracers, or students tested for other reasons.

Random surveillance testing done between Sept 23 and Nov 22.
